About This Property
FOR RENT - THIRD FLOOD PENTHOUSE - This is the premier loft condominium in all of Downtown Mobile right in the arts and entertainment district. This unique third floor Penthouse unit has 2,700 square feet of living space with two bedrooms and two baths. The beautiful brick floors were hand cut from the demolition of the building next door. This building was originally purchased after the entire building burned down and was completely rebuilt from the ground up. Located above the iconic Crescent Theater, the unit boasts granite countertops, stainless appliances and soaring ceiling height with exposed beams. Other amenities include in-unit laundry, plenty of storage and large master bedroom. Three sets of Beautiful French doors open to a spacious balcony overlooking Dauphin St. Enjoy quiet mornings with your coffee as you watch the city come alive or enjoy being a most popular person during Mardi Gras as you and your friends relax on your private perch to watch the festivities. There is a gated private parking lot next door for owners. Walk from your car to the rear alleyway entrance to the elevator that opens directly into your unit. Located just west of the Mobile River, Downtown Mobile is known for its historic charm, modern apartments for rent, and waterfront parks. Bienville Square sits in the heart of this commercial hub with large trees, a lawn, paved paths, and a decorative fountain. This urban green space is host to a variety of events throughout the year like the Bayfest Music Festival. Cathedral Square Park is a cultural focal point for events such as the Artwalk. To enjoy views of the river, be sure to check out the paved paths at Cooper Riverside Park.
Interstate 10 runs through the district’s southeast corner, offering easy access to other areas in the city, including Baltimore and Arlington. Operating in an 1836 historic landmark building, Spot of Tea serves eggs cathedral and crab bisque soup. At Five Bar, locals enjoy listening to jazz with their shrimp and grits during Sunday brunch.
